Cinco de Mayo is a holiday originating in Mexico that is also widely celebrated throughout other parts of the world, especially the United States. Taking place on the 5th of May, Cinco de Mayo marks the anniversary of Mexico's victory over the Second French Empire at the Battle of Puebla in 1862. Modern traditions to commemorate the holiday.

Ideas for Cinco de Mayo social media posts Cinco de Mayo translates as the fifth of May - try incorporating the number five into your social media promotions. You could offer prizes for the 5,000 th like, give out goodie bags to the first five people who share your post, or offer 10% off for every fifth customer.

Cinco de Mayo (Spanish for the Fifth of May) celebrates the Mexican Army's unexpected victory over the invading French Army on May 5, 1862. Aside from defeating what had been considered the best army in the world, Mexico's victory prevented France from establishing a base it could use to aid the Confederate Army during the U.S. Civil War.
